Key West Grilled Chicken with Tropical Citrus Marinade

Key West Grilled Chicken features tender chicken breasts marinated in a tropical citrus blend of lime, orange, and lemon with garlic, cumin, and coriander. Perfect for summer cookouts with vibrant, zesty flavors.

  • Total Time: 2 hours 19 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1/2 cup fresh lime juice
  • 1/2 cup fresh orange juice
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on ground coriander
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• Zest of 1 lime
  • Zest of 1 orange
  • Fresh cilantro for garnish

Instructions

  1. Combine lime juice, orange juice, lemon juice, soy sauce, olive oil, honey, garlic, cumin, coriander, salt, pepper, lime zest, and orange zest to make the marinade.
  2. Place chicken in a resealable bag or shallow dish, pour marinade over, seal, and refrigerate at least 2 hours.
  3. Preheat grill to medium-high, lightly oil grates.
  4. Remove chicken from marinade, discard excess, and grill 6-7 minutes per side until internal temperature reaches 165°F.
  5. Let rest 5 minutes, garnish with cilantro, and serve.

Notes

  •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for heat.
  • Pairs well with grilled pineapple or mango salsa.
  • Can use a stovetop grill pan if outdoor grill is unavailable.
  • Pound chicken to even thickness for consistent cooking.
